    I have been playing Rift since launch and love every minute of it. I also have an active recurring 6 month sub for WoW. WoW is still fun at times but is starting to show a little age. I log on to play with my guildmates for scheduled raids,etc.

    Everyone is entitled to their own opinion but i just dont understand the people that say Rift is boring. How is it boring. If you played the first 20 levels i could possibly see your point because you dont have all your talents/abilities. Thats called leveling up..You started off in WoW just the same but with a lot less choices and abilities within those first 20 levels. Class design in Rift is just amazing. At level 15 you basically have 8 classes at your disposal to respec whenever you want at barely any cost. While were on the topic of Specs, you can also have up to 4 saved specs. Along with the unlocking of the PvP soul, which gives you more survival and bigger burst, for only 2500 favor (Rifts honor is you will) I just dont see how thats just not amazing..

    Rifts/Invasions: To be honest Freemarch is not the best "first impression" of Rift/Invasion activity for most. Personally i enjoyed it, but especially right now with the Death invasion events going on it can be a little overwhelming at first glance. In zones 30+, especially in IPP and Stillmoor the invasions are an amazing public World Raid experience with objective lists to unlock the final Boss, which drops nice rewards that everyone receives for participation. Hell the NPC's will even chip in. If left to invade, the zone is crippled until cleaned up. Your towns and quest hubs are overwhelmed. Overall its an awesome experience and a great solution to support a helpful community.

    People that complain about not finding groups to do dungeons with, im sorry but everytime i put myself out there LFG i get immediate responses. Im also in a sizable guild so lately i just ask in guild chat and have plenty of raised hands. People have been asking for a LFD tool. I say hell no, at least if its anything like WoW's. I refuse to PuG in WoW at all just for the fact the community is god awful. If i havent played with you before I dont run it in WoW, enough said.

    Addons: Addons are cool when they are not used as the standard. UI in RIFT is fully customizable, they only thing i have an issue with is the portraits in my Player/Target frames but its not game breaking. Things like Recount and GS have no place here. In RIFT group make up consists of Tank/Heals/DPS/Support. I mean Real support, like having a Bard or Chloro for example in a group those buffs are great to have. Chloro..OMG a mage that can Battle rez heal and buff up, wow. So going off something like Recount in RIFT would just be dumb.

    PvP: RIFT seems to be a more PvE oriented game. While I enjoy the Warfronts and PvP, I do not want to see a competitive PvP system brought in i.e. Arenas. Classes are unique and very enjoyable to play as is, I would rather not have the overwhelming balancing and just kick it around in a Warfront from time to time. I have heard people complaing about balancing issues already, yet your in playing in a x1-x9 bracket for gods sake. If someone 2 or 4 levels higher kicked your ass, your class doesnt suck its the level difference. Also for those that have complained about only having 2 Warfronts..wrong again. Another game that you have played only had 2 BG's open around 20 levels. Theres Black Garden (nice twist to capture the flag), The Codex (Comparable to AB but awesome), Whitefall Steepes (comparable to WSG), The Battle of Port Scion (sort of AV).

    People should just play the game, level to cap and enjoy themselves before making statements of how the game sucks at 20 or even 30 or when they played beta. Personally as long as my guild in WoW sticks around I will be enjoying both games for a long time.
